How much do remote traveling project eng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 6, 2026, the average yearly pay for remote traveling project engineer in Washington, DC is $91,398.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$78,100.00 and $100,200.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

The Remote Traveling Project Engineer typically manages projects remotely while traveling to various sites, focusing on planning and coordination. In contrast, a Field Service Engineer works directly on-site to install, repair, or maintain equipment. Both roles require technical skills and travel, but the Project Engineer emphasizes project oversight, whereas the Field Service Engineer focuses on hands-on technical support.
